Evaluating Games Beyond the Headline Count
A large game catalogue can be attractive, but the total number of titles does not tell the whole story. Variety matters more when it reflects different playing styles. Some users prefer short, feature-rich slot sessions, while others choose blackjack, roulette, baccarat, or live dealer tables with streamed interaction.
| Game category | Typical appeal | Key details to check |
|---|---|---|
| Video slots | Quick sessions and varied themes | Volatility, paylines, RTP, and bonus features |
| Live casino | Dealer-led play with real-time streaming | Table limits, studio quality, and available schedules |
| Roulette | Simple rules and multiple betting options | Wheel variant, limits, and game speed |
| Jackpot games | Progressive prize potential | Prize conditions and contribution rules |
Players should also review return-to-player information and volatility where available. RTP is a long-term statistical measure, not a promise for any individual session. Volatility indicates how frequently and dramatically results may vary, so it can help users select games that better match their preferred pace.
Bonuses Need a Detailed Reading
Promotional offers can add value, yet their real conditions are often more important than the advertised headline. A welcome package may involve a minimum deposit, selected games, maximum qualifying amounts, wagering requirements, or a limited redemption period.
Questions Worth Asking Before Opting In
- Which deposits and payment methods qualify?
- How many times must bonus funds or winnings be wagered?
- Are certain games excluded or assigned reduced contribution rates?
- Is there a maximum bet while the offer is active?
- What happens if the player withdraws before completing the terms?
Reading the complete promotion page helps prevent misunderstandings. Some sites also offer cashback, reload rewards, free spins, tournaments, or loyalty points. These promotions can suit different playing habits, but none should encourage spending beyond a planned entertainment budget.
Payments, Withdrawals, and Account Security
Reliable banking is one of the strongest indicators of a polished platform. Before depositing, players should confirm whether their preferred method is supported, whether fees apply, and how long withdrawals normally take. Verification requests are common, particularly before a first withdrawal, and may include identity or address documents.
Security deserves equal attention. Look for encrypted connections, responsible data practices, two-factor authentication where available, and transparent licensing information. A reputable operator should explain how personal details are handled and provide clear procedures for closing or restricting an account.
Responsible Play Should Shape the Decision
Casino games are designed for entertainment, and outcomes remain uncertain. Setting limits before playing can make the experience easier to control. Useful measures include deposit caps, session reminders,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ion tools. Players should avoid chasing losses, borrowing money to gamble, or treating casino play as an income source.
